Overview
As a placement 西瓜视频, you will engage with stakeholders from your assigned customer account to build trust and ensure service excellence. You will collaborate with teams like Sales, Service Delivery, and Project Management to identify opportunities to add value to contracted services and drive growth. The role involves daily communication, supporting service reviews, and helping to resolve issues - offering valuable exposure to customer relationship management and the wider business.
Skills
During my placement, I developed strong communication, relationship management, and leadership skills. Engaging with customer stakeholders helped me improve how I convey information clearly and build trust. Quarterly checkpoints with senior stakeholders gave me opportunities to build confidence and communicate effectively when presenting. I also learned new Excel tips and techniques which enhanced my data analysis and reporting abilities. Overall, this experience boosted my confidence in managing professional relationships and bringing teams together to collaborate effectively.
Responsibilities
Throughout my placement, I had the opportunity to manage and oversee some of our contracted service lines, which gave me valuable insight into real-life service delivery. As part of this, I actively managed customer escalations and queries, led team meetings, and was responsible for supporting contract changes.
Support & Guidance
I was assigned both a buddy and a mentor, who I had regular daily interactions with, as well as weekly check-ins with my manager to ensure everything was on track. This support structure made me feel comfortable operating on the account and asking questions. Computacenter is known for its warm, friendly culture, and that really shows. Colleagues across the business are always happy to offer help and guidance.
Culture
The company culture at Computacenter is inclusive, engaging, and community-driven, with plenty of opportunities to get involved outside of work. For example, during South Asian Heritage Month and Black History Month, Computacenter and its partners hosted a range of initiatives across all office locations. There is also a weekly five-a-side football league near the Blackfriars office. These initiatives help create a welcoming environment and offer great opportunities to connect with colleagues beyond your department.

One piece of advice I would give to others applying is to genuinely be yourself and let your values shine through. Be open to new opportunities and experiences, they are key to developing professionally and expanding your network. Computacenter does not look for identical candidates; everyone brings something different, so understand what sets you apart and highlight it in the application process. Once in role, maintain a balance of being professional while staying friendly and approachable too.
